San Pablo gears up for summer movie nights and July 4th celebration
The San Pablo Community Services Department is set to launch its popular \"Movies Under the Stars\" program, running from June 15 to August 19. The outdoor movie screenings will begin at 6:30 PM, with attendees encouraged to arrive by 6 PM. Due to anticipated weather conditions, the program will be held indoors at the San Pablo Community Center, and registration is required. Interested participants can find more details on the city’s official website.

Additionally, the city is gearing up for its annual Fourth of July multicultural celebration, scheduled for July 4 from 5 PM to 9 PM at the San Pablo Community Center. This year’s event will feature a tribute performance by the band Viva Santana and an expanded drone light show, replacing the traditional fireworks display, which received positive feedback from the community. Attendees can look forward to live music, food, carnival games, and various entertainment options. More information about the event can also be accessed through the city’s website.
